Directed NPI integration, tooling design, and manufacturing compliance validation for multi-million dollar ophthalmic surgical arm assemblies.

Engineering Process

Established rigid BOM hierarchies and sub-assembly structures in SolidWorks PDM.

Managed configurations to isolate critical component tolerances, ensuring precise clearance margins for surgical-grade optical components.

Coordinated revisions through official Engineering Change Orders (ECOs) directly mapped into Windchill PLM.

Built custom laser-welding fixtures and alignment jigs to reduce assembly errors during pilot builds.

Optimized part geometry for Swiss-type machining and precise anodized coatings.

Formulated detailed Assembly flowcharts, standard operating procedures, and Device Master Records (DMR) to transfer fabrication from R&D to factory floor operations.

Executed standard Installation, Operational, and Performance Qualifications (IQ/OQ/PQ) for automated calibration benches.

Coordinated First Article Inspections (FAI) and Material Review Board (MRB) dispositions to assure 99.8%+ production repeatability yield metrics.
